Introduction
Just Like Someone Without Mental Illness Only More So: A Memoir is an autobiographical work by Dr. Mark Vonnegut, a physician by profession. In these pages, the author recounts his personal experience with bipolar disorder, offering a unique perspective from the dual gaze of patient and health professional. The title, suggestive and profound, invites reflection on the complexity of living with a condition that is often invisible but marks every aspect of life.
What is this book about?
This memoir explores the ups and downs of a life marked by bipolar disorder. From the early episodes to diagnosis and treatment, Dr. Vonnegut shares his journey with honesty and courage. The book is not only a personal testimony but also a tool for better understanding this mental illness. Through its pages, readers can delve into the reality of a condition that affects millions of people worldwide.
